| Product Name | LF Card Inlay (125KHz Prelam) |
| Operating Frequency | 125KHz (LF) |
| Standards | ISO 11784/11785 |
| Chip Options | TK4100, EM4200, EM4305, T5577, Hitag 1/2/S |
| Substrate | Brand-new PVC or PET |
| Thickness | 0.50-0.55 mm |
| Antenna | Multi-turn wound copper coil |
| Layouts | 2-5, 5-5 (standard or completely flat) |
| Quality Control | 100% electrical performance test per inlay; ISO 9001: 2015 |
| Print Markings | Trimmed reference edges, optional printed cross marks |
| MOQ | 1,000 sheets (production); samples available |
| Lead Time | 12-20 business days |

2Why LF inlay supply is scarce
Low-frequency antennas need many turns of copper wire to reach 125KHz, and most wire-planting machines cannot lay them cleanly, so many factories stopped making LF prelam. RFIDAK kept the capability and supplies consistent LF inlay worldwide, which is why buyers with legacy EM/TK4100 programs often source LF inlay here when other suppliers only offer HF.

3Why the 125KHz coil is the hard part
To resonate at 125KHz an antenna needs many turns of fine copper wire — far more than a 13.56MHz loop. Most automatic wire-planting machines cannot lay that many turns cleanly, which is why a lot of factories quietly dropped LF prelam and now only quote HF.
The wire itself is the constraint: stable impedance, uniform diameter, quick to soften and harden so it demoulds cleanly. Uneven wire gives you coils that sit proud, cards that show a coil print, and read range that varies across the sheet.

4Wound automatically, not by hand
Hand-laid coils deform, sit unevenly and leave a visible print on the finished card. Automatic implanting places every turn with the same gap, which is what makes 125KHz read performance repeatable from the first sheet of a run to the last.
LF inlays are also thicker than HF for this reason — 0.50–0.55 mm against 0.40–0.50 mm — because the coil simply needs the depth. Layouts are 2×5 and 5×5, in normal-standard or completely flat form.

6What we check on an LF inlay
TK4100, EM4200, EM4305, T5577 and Hitag chips are each read back on the test platform before the sheet is released. Thickness matters more on LF than on any other format, because the extra coil depth is exactly what jams a press if it drifts.
| What is checked | Instrument | Coverage |
|---|---|---|
| Chip response and read/write | Multi-chip test platform with reader and terminal | 100% of units |
| Antenna resonance frequency | Bode 100 vector network analyser | Setup + in-process |
| Inlay thickness | Digital height gauge | Per sheet lot |
| Chip-to-antenna bond strength | Push-force instrument | Per shift |
| Bond joint condition | Stereo microscope | Per shift |
| Substrate identity and density | Precision density balance | Incoming material (IQC) |
| Ageing and lamination survival | Constant temperature and humidity chamber | Qualification + periodic |
